Softball Capitalizes on Mistakes to Edge Pasadena

Softball Capitalizes on Mistakes to Edge Pasadena

El Camino College plated the go-ahead runs on mistakes by Pasadena in a 3-1 South Coast Conference road victory Friday afternoon at Jackie Robinson Park.

The Warriors (9-3, 7-1) scored twice in the top of the seventh inning thanks to a pair of Pasadena mistakes to break a 1-1 tie and eventually take the win.

Six different players recorded a hit for the Warriors and Elizabeth Cortez recorded a complete-game victory in the circle, allowing one unearned run on eight hits.

With the game tied at one in the seventh, Vanessa Romero hit a one-out double to put the go-ahead run in scoring position. That run would come around to score as Diamond Lewis reached on a dropped fly ball in center field. Lewis would then steal third and score on a throwing error by the catcher to give ECC a 3-1 advantage and they never looked back.

Cortez tallied four strikeouts on the day and allowed just one walk in the seventh inning while retiring the side to secure the win.

The Warriors will return to action Tuesday afternoon with a road game at Cerritos. First pitch is scheduled for 3 p.m.
